**'The marker you should judge all other time-travelling narratives by' Guardian** n n Octavia E. Butler's masterpiece and ground-breaking exploration of power and responsibility, for fans of The Handmaid's Tale, The Power and Yaa Gyasi's Homegoing. With an original foreword by Ayobami Adebayo. n n '[Her] evocative, often troubling, novels explore far-reaching issues of race, sex, power and, ultimately, what it means to be human' New York Times n n 'No novel I've read this year has felt as relevant, as gut-wrenching or as essential' The Pool n n In 1976, Dana dreams of being a writer. In 1815, she is assumed a slave. n n When Dana first meets Rufus on a Maryland plantation, he's drowning. She saves his life - and it will happen again and again. n n Neither of them understands his power to summon her whenever his life is threatened, nor the significance of the ties that bind them. n n And each time Dana saves him, the more aware she is that her own life might be over before it's even begun. n n Octavia E. Butler's ground-breaking masterpiece is the extraordinary story of two people bound by blood, separated by so much more than time. n n What readers are saying about KINDRED: n n 'It was written in 1979 but could have been written last year.
